ADO versus DAO
Dalam visual Basic terdapat tiga antarmuka akses data, yaitu: Data Access Objects(DAO), Remote Data Objects(RDO) dan ActiveX Data Objects(ADO). Model pemrograman RDO mirip dengan model DAO hanya saja RDO didesain untuk bekerja dengan database client-server. Sedangkan ADO merupakan kontrol data bawaan Visual Basic 6.
DAO dan ADO, kedua kontrol tersebut melakukan hal yang sama yaitu menyediakan tool untuk bekerja dengan engine database dalam mengelola database. ADO adalah teknologi yang akan menggantikan DAO karena memiliki kinerja yang lebih baik mendukung aplikasi client-server dan web.
Terus Bagaimana? “Pilih DAO atau ADO…”
Alasan menggunakan DAO daripada ADO?
- Jika anda memodifikasi aplikasi yang sebelumnya dibuat menggunakan DAO.
- Jika anda mengembangkan aplikasi small dekstop.
- Kontrol DAO sekarang(versi 3.51 pada VB6) menyediakan sekuriti database yang lebih baik.
- Ms. Acess menggunakan DAO.
Alasan menggunakan ADO daripada DAO?
- Anda memulai proyek baru dengan kemungkinan menggunakan Internet.
- ADO lebih mudah digunakan daripada DAO.
- ADO merupakan kontrol yang poweful karena dapat mengakses sumber data lainnya misalnya SQL server.
- Jika anda tidak menggunakan engine JET(Joint Engine Technology).
- ADO akan menjadi satu-satunya kontrol data sedangkan DAO akan menjadi obsolete.
Download link dokumen: Visual Basic (ADO vs DAO?)
0 komentar:
Posting Komentar